Output d954e8d8f7e27dad6a91fe21b3fdfc112b4d100d72e4cd34c6d2121e9fa844cb:154

value
74404
script pubkey
OP_0 OP_PUSHBYTES_20 f61c32ac48e1730d7214013f30bf87e45288ebaa
address
bc1q7cwr9tzgu9es6us5qylnp0u8u3fg36a2u0lgnd
transaction
d954e8d8f7e27dad6a91fe21b3fdfc112b4d100d72e4cd34c6d2121e9fa844cb
confirmations
128694
spent
true